Address

RwBhMfVseSqpzd1CVrmVQcknScZqD7MLu3

364.51214023 RDD
0.15 CNY

Confirmed
Total Received364.51214023 RDD0.15 CNY
Total Sent0 RDD0.00 CNY
Final Balance364.51214023 RDD0.15 CNY
No. Transactions1

Transactions

RpXBbVu4bAbYczAJN54jfohUy36u4peKvr764.99999000 RDD116.69 CNY0.32 CNY
 
RfYCKtsZqKYJfcURqNNTDvFEWuEPW6Qy8N400.47784977 RDD61.09 CNY0.17 CNY
RwBhMfVseSqpzd1CVrmVQcknScZqD7MLu3364.51214023 RDD55.60 CNY0.15 CNY×